The Letter of Inquiry is part of the grantmaking process because it would be overwhelming and time-consuming for funders to review 15-page proposals from everyone seeking money. For instance, research-focused grants often benefit from reviewers who understand the complexities of proposed studies, while community programs can engage past grantees to offer informed feedback. This approach is particularly effective for programs requiring deep technical knowledge or community-driven perspectives.
